Top 10 Benefits of Acupuncture
- Deanna Carell
- Aug 12
- 2 min read
Updated: 6 days ago
Welcome to the World of Acupuncture!
Whether you’re brand new to acupuncture or already a big fan, there’s always something new to discover about this powerful form of holistic care. From boosting your immune system to easing stress, acupuncture offers a wide range of benefits that support your body, mind, and spirit.
Here are 10 amazing ways acupuncture can help you feel your best:

1. Strengthens Your Immune System
Think of acupuncture as a gentle nudge that helps your immune system wake up and get to work. Each point activated in a treatment encourages your body to produce immune cells that fight off viruses and bacteria both naturally and effectively.
2. Eases Allergy Symptoms
Seasonal allergies making you miserable? Acupuncture can bring quick relief from nasal congestion, itchy eyes, and sinus pressure, sometimes even after just one session. It’s also great for keeping symptoms at bay when allergy season rolls back around.
3. Supports Healthy Weight Loss
No crash diets here! Acupuncture works with your body to reduce cravings, support digestion, and regulate appetite. Combined with simple lifestyle shifts, it can help you achieve and maintain a healthier, more balanced weight.
4. Relieves Migraines
Migraines are more than just headaches, they can seriously disrupt your life. Acupuncture offers a safe, drug-free way to ease migraine pain and reduce how often they occur, without the side effects of medication.
5. Helps with Everyday Headaches
Whether they’re tension-related or just part of a stressful week, acupuncture can help loosen tight muscles, ease pressure, and clear your mind. Pair it with things like massage, movement, and hydration for even better results.
6. Improves Sleep & Fights Insomnia
Can’t sleep? Many people fall into a deep, restful nap during their acupuncture session! Over time, regular treatments can help reset your sleep cycles, especially when combined with simple tweaks like cutting back on caffeine or sugar.
7. Supports Emotional Wellness
Feeling overwhelmed or emotionally off balance? Acupuncture helps calm the nervous system, reduce stress hormones, and support emotional stability. It’s a gentle and natural complement to therapy, or a great starting point if you’re looking for holistic mental health support.
8. Boosts Fertility & Reproductive Health
Acupuncture has long been used to support fertility for both women and men. By reducing stress, regulating cycles, and supporting hormone balance, treatments can play a powerful role in your fertility journey, whether you’re just starting out or working with a reproductive specialist.
9. Soothes Back Pain
Whether it’s tight muscles, tension from sitting, or an old injury flaring up, acupuncture can help relieve pain by improving circulation and triggering your body’s natural release of endorphins (aka feel-good chemicals).
10. Calms the Mind & Reduces Stress
Acupuncture is a built-in pause button. It helps relax your muscles, slow your breathing, and shift your body out of “fight-or-flight” mode. Whether you need a quick reset or ongoing support, acupuncture is a go-to for restoring calm and clarity.
Comments